(Mytour.vn) - Nếu bạn có hai máy tính chạy hai hệ điều hành khác nhau là Windows và Linux, bạn sẽ muốn biết cách chia sẻ dữ liệu giữa chúng. Bài viết này sẽ hướng dẫn bạn cách làm điều đó một cách đơn giản và hiệu quả.
Nếu bạn sử dụng hai máy tính với hai hệ điều hành khác nhau là Windows và Linux, bạn sẽ cần biết cách thiết lập chia sẻ dữ liệu giữa chúng. Bài viết này sẽ hướng dẫn bạn cách làm điều đó một cách dễ dàng và hiệu quả.
Bài viết này sẽ hướng dẫn bạn cách thiết lập một thư mục trên Windows để máy tính sử dụng Linux có thể truy cập vào và ngược lại, thông qua mạng LAN giữa hai máy tính.
Hướng dẫn này có thể áp dụng cho tất cả các phiên bản Windows (bao gồm cả Windows 8.1) và Linux (như Ubuntu chẳng hạn).
Cách thiết lập chia sẻ trên Windows
Để thiết lập một thư mục chia sẻ trên Windows cho Linux truy cập, hãy bắt đầu bằng cách đảm bảo các cài đặt mạng của bạn đã được cấu hình để cho phép kết nối từ các máy tính khác bằng cách mở Trung tâm Mạng và Chia sẻ.
Trong Trung tâm Mạng và Chia sẻ, bạn chọn Thay đổi cài đặt chia sẻ nâng cao.
Đánh dấu vào hai tùy chọn “Bật khám phá mạng” và “Bật chia sẻ tập tin và máy in”. Sau đó nhấn “Lưu Thay đổi” để hoàn tất.
Tiếp theo, bạn tạo một thư mục trong ổ đĩa và đặt tên tuỳ ý, ví dụ như “Chia sẻ”. Nhấn chuột phải vào thư mục này, chọn Thuộc tính, chọn tab Chia sẻ và nhấn vào Chia sẻ nâng cao.
Bây giờ, đánh dấu vào tùy chọn “Chia sẻ thư mục này” và nhấn vào Quyền.
Trong cửa sổ Quyền, bạn thiết lập các hạn chế cho việc truy cập và chỉnh sửa thư mục chia sẻ bằng cách đánh dấu các tùy chọn. Khi đã xong, nhấn OK để lưu lại.
Tiếp theo, chuyển qua tab “Bảo mật” để thêm người dùng hoặc cài đặt các quyền khác cho thư mục. Sau khi đã cài đặt xong, nhấn OK để lưu lại tất cả.
Một lưu ý khác là bạn cần nhớ tên máy tính của mình. Bạn có thể kiểm tra bằng cách nhập “This PC” vào Menu Start, nhấn chuột phải vào kết quả và chọn Thuộc tính để xem tên máy tính.
Hướng dẫn kết nối từ Linux đến Windows
Trên Linux, bạn có thể thực hiện các thao tác trên giao diện đồ họa, nhưng tốt nhất là sử dụng dòng lệnh để thuận tiện hơn.
Đầu tiên, bạn cần cài đặt gói cifs-utils để gắn kết các thư mục SMB bằng lệnh
sudo apt-get install cifs-utils
Sau đó, sử dụng lệnh để tạo và gắn kết thư mục được chia sẻ từ máy tính Windows
sudo mount.cifs //Tên-Máy-Windows/Chia-Sẻ /home/tên-người-dùng/Desktop/Windows-Share -o user=tên-người-dùng
Như bạn đã thấy, tôi đã nhập mật khẩu gốc của Linux và mật khẩu của tài khoản “geek” trên Windows vào câu lệnh. Sau khi thực hiện lệnh này, bạn sẽ có thể truy cập vào thư mục và xem nội dung bên trong thư mục được chia sẻ từ Windows.
Lưu ý:
‘sudo mount.cifs’ là lệnh để gắn kết thư mục chia sẻ.
‘WindowsPC’ ở đây là tên của máy tính chạy Windows.
‘//Tên-Máy-Windows/Chia-Sẻ’ là đường dẫn của thư mục trên Windows.
‘/home/tên-người-dùng/Desktop/Windows-Share’ là đường dẫn của thư mục để gắn kết với Linux.
‘-o user=tên-người-dùng’ là tên người dùng trên Windows, được sử dụng để truy cập vào thư mục.
Hướng dẫn chia sẻ trên Linux
Để chia sẻ một thư mục trên Linux để Windows truy cập, bạn bắt đầu bằng cách cài đặt Samba bằng lệnh sau
sudo apt-get install samba
Tiếp theo, bạn cấu hình tên và mật khẩu sử dụng để truy cập, ở đây tôi chọn ‘geek’ làm tên tài khoản truy cập.
smbpasswd -a geek
Sau đó, tạo một thư mục chia sẻ trên màn hình Desktop của Linux và đặt tên là “Chia Sẻ”
mkdir ~/Desktop/Chia-Sẻ
Bây giờ, tôi sẽ cấu hình thư mục này bằng cách nhập dòng lệnh sau để mở tập tin “smb.conf”
sudo vi /etc/samba/smb.conf
Tiếp theo, tôi sẽ tiến hành cấu hình cho tập tin smb.conf như sau
[tên_thư_mục]
đường_dẫn = /home/tên_người_dùng/tên_thư_mục
available = yes
người_dùng_hợp_lệ = tên_người_dùng
read only = không
browsable = có
public = có
writable = có
Cụ thể là
Lưu và đóng tập tin sau khi chỉnh sửa xong. Bây giờ, bạn hãy khởi động lại dịch vụ SMB để thay đổi có hiệu lực bằng cách sử dụng lệnh sau
sudo service smbd restart
Hướng dẫn kết nối đến Linux từ Windows
Bây giờ, để kết nối đến thư mục chia sẻ trên Linux từ Windows, bạn nhấn chuột phải vào màn hình Desktop và chọn New > Shortcut
Nhập địa chỉ IP và tên thư mục của Linux vào. Ví dụ
Nếu bạn không biết địa chỉ IP của máy tính Linux, hãy sử dụng lệnh sau trên Linux
ifconfig
Nhấn Next và đặt một tên tùy ý cho Shortcut này. Đó là mọi thứ, khi cần truy cập vào thư mục chia sẻ trên Linux, bạn chỉ cần nhấp đôi chuột vào Shortcut này.
Hy vọng bài viết sẽ hữu ích cho bạn, chúc bạn thành công.